aboutsummaryrefslogtreecommitdiffstats
path: root/driver.c
diff options
context:
space:
mode:
authorEric S. Raymond <esr@thyrsus.com>1997-04-05 16:57:50 +0000
committerEric S. Raymond <esr@thyrsus.com>1997-04-05 16:57:50 +0000
commit93025e3732f2b312516ecb059768a3577c9e46f1 (patch)
tree0c5b2c62fed52989050e6f529a769d9a2c01709a /driver.c
parent53b50716e3d468da291c646829671f794bf034f0 (diff)
downloadfetchmail-93025e3732f2b312516ecb059768a3577c9e46f1.tar.gz
fetchmail-93025e3732f2b312516ecb059768a3577c9e46f1.tar.bz2
fetchmail-93025e3732f2b312516ecb059768a3577c9e46f1.zip
Robert de Bath's changes.
svn path=/trunk/; revision=952
Diffstat (limited to 'driver.c')
-rw-r--r--driver.c7
1 files changed, 4 insertions, 3 deletions
diff --git a/driver.c b/driver.c
index 4fa9e73c..9045fcc7 100644
--- a/driver.c
+++ b/driver.c
@@ -710,7 +710,8 @@ char *realname; /* real name of host */
if (!ctl->mda && ((sinkfp = smtp_open(ctl)) == NULL))
{
free_str_list(&xmit_names);
- error(0, 0, "SMTP connect to %s failed", ctl->smtphost);
+ error(0, 0, "SMTP connect to %s failed",
+ ctl->smtphost ? ctl->smtphost : "localhost");
if (return_path)
free(return_path);
return(PS_SMTP);
@@ -1070,7 +1071,7 @@ char *realname; /* real name of host */
signal(SIGCHLD, sigchld);
if (rc)
{
- error(0, 0, "MDA exited abnormally or returned nonzero status");
+ error(0, -1, "MDA exited abnormally or returned nonzero status");
return(PS_IOERR);
}
}
@@ -1079,7 +1080,7 @@ char *realname; /* real name of host */
/* write message terminator */
if (SMTP_eom(sinkfp) != SM_OK)
{
- error(0, 0, "SMTP listener refused delivery");
+ error(0, -1, "SMTP listener refused delivery");
ctl->errcount++;
return(PS_TRANSIENT);
}